A Guide to Phosphatidic Acid Supplements Primeval Labs

WebThese phospholipids are present in liquid lecithin: Phosphatidylcholine (PC, 14–16%) Phosphatidylethanolamine (PE,10–15%) Phosphatidylinositol (PI, 10–15%) Phosphatidic acid (PA, 5–12%) Chemistry Soybean lecithins also contain triglycerides, sterols, small quantities of fatty acids and carbohydrates. WebSide Effects. When taken by mouth: Lecithin is commonly consumed in foods. It is likely safe when taken as a supplement in doses up to 30 grams daily for up to 6 weeks.
